## Artifact Signing — Faresmith Rules Engine

Faresmith evaluates shipping-fee rules compiled into versioned rule packs. Because a tampered rule pack could silently change customer charges, every pack must be signed before the runtime will load it. As a contractor, you build packs locally but sign them through the CI signer; never sign on your laptop. The runtime pins a single trusted key per environment and rejects everything else. The currently pinned key for the sandbox environment is as follows.

release key, kawif-hawep: bky13_X7TGuRG4Zu4ZJ

### Account Recovery — Catalogue Import (Lintwood)

Quick one for review: when the Lintwood catalogue import wipes a patron's session table, the recovery flow re-seeds accounts from the nightly snapshot. Check that the importer skips locked accounts — last time it didn't. To rerun recovery against staging you'll need the vault passphrase, which is appended just below.

recovery phrase for yafof-tajof: julmir-kelax-julvan-holath-belvan-holir-ralael-ralvan-ralath-julvan-silmir-istmir-kaswyn-ulamir

- [ ] **Step 7: Breaker override escrow.** After sealing the signing keys for the Tallgrove upstream API circuit breaker, confirm the support team can force the breaker open during a full outage. The override bundle lives in the sealed escrow drawer and is useless without its unlock phrase. Two ceremony witnesses must initial this step before proceeding. The escrow bundle is decrypted with the recovery passphrase that follows.

vault phrase of kahip-kahop = holath-quenmir

## v0.14.0 — Key rotation

Hey plugin folks — we rotated the signing key for Schemabeck, the event schema registry, as part of routine hygiene. Nothing changes in the API: schema fetch, validation, and compat checks all work as before. You just need to update the key your plugin uses to verify registry responses, or verification will start failing after the 30-day grace window. The new key is right here.

rollout seal: bky4_x7Gc